Transaction 899bd326be3f11e16e094aa1e3c3969cf76d74df593f407843887f6f0f313d01
1 Input
1 Output
-
899bd326be3f11e16e094aa1e3c3969cf76d74df593f407843887f6f0f313d01:0
- value
- 21832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5c28ebff1637ca8629d854f733cefc17eb367aa OP_EQUAL
- address
- 3MBGvWB3ggQfsY6mgEkaGQDmkzR9osA599